Abstract
The utility model provides a kind of deicer for power transmission line, and described device comprises induction electricity getting device (1), remote-control laser generation equipment (2), reserve battery (3); Described remote-control laser generation equipment (2) comprises laser generator and remote signal receiver.A kind of deicer for power transmission line that the utility model provides, has solved winter transmission line and icing problem has occurred because of the situation such as snow, and deicing efficiency is high, and can guarantee staff's safety.

Background technology
Transmission line is the important channel of electrical network transmission of electric energy.The operating condition of transmission line directly affects the safe and stable operation of whole electric power system.In the winter time, after particularly snowing, transmission line can freeze because temperature reduces, when serious, likely cause transmission line generation ice to dodge and cause transmission line tripping operation, the even more serious serious accident that even may freeze and cause steel tower to be toppled over completely because of transmission line, therefore, transmission line freezes and should give timely elimination.In prior art, mainly by artificial deicing, inefficiency and abnormally dangerous.

Embodiment
Below in conjunction with drawings and Examples, the utility model is described in further detail.Following examples are used for illustrating the utility model, but can not be used for limiting scope of the present utility model.
Fig. 1 is the structural representation of a kind of deicer for power transmission line of a preferred embodiment of the present utility model; Described device comprises induction electricity getting device 1, remote-control laser generation equipment 2, reserve battery 3; Described remote-control laser generation equipment 2 comprises laser generator and remote signal receiver; The terminals of described induction electricity getting device 1 connect respectively power transmission line overhead ground wire and iron tower of power transmission line; The positive and negative electrode of the voltage output end of described induction electricity getting device connects respectively the positive and negative electrode of described reserve battery 3; The voltage output end of described reserve battery 3 connects the voltage input end of described laser generator and the voltage input end of described remote signal receiver; The signal output part of described remote signal receiver connects the start end of described laser generator; The Laser emission end of described laser generator is aimed at laser hole 4.
Operation principle: induction electricity getting device 1 one ends are connected on the ground wire of overhead transmission line, and the other end is connected to iron tower of power transmission line, and laser remote sensing generation equipment 2 is supplied with in its output gives reserve battery 3 chargings simultaneously.When transmission line is stopped transport, have reserve battery power supply, deicer still can continue to send the ice that laser is removed locality.The utility model is installed on to power transmission line overhead ground wire near steel tower place, laser hole is aimed to insulator string and connecting position of wires.In the winter time, during O&M personnel line walking, utilize remote controller, can start deicer.
